AFCEA turns the spotlight on cybersecurity: cloud on the shields

The conference of the “Armed Forces Communications and Electronics Association”, has highlighted the potentiality and the risks which are related to the use of the cloud in the Armed Forces

April 29, 2015

It took place in Rome, at the prestigious Department of Automated Information Systems (Resia) of It Air Force, the conference of AFCEA (Armed Forces Communications and Electronics Association) “CyberDefence over Cloud: views, experiences and recommendations”.

Colonel Costantino Russo, which is the Commander in Chief of RESIA, opened the conference with the AFCEA Rome Chapter president, General Antonio Tangorra.

During the conference it was shown the state of the art on the italian Cloud presented by Fabio Rizzotto from IDC Italy and the methodologies for the Cloud Security Governance presented by Alberto Manfredi, CEO of “Cloud Security Alliance Italy.

The Lieutenant Colonel Resta has explained the route taken by the IT Air Force and the Italian engineer Nocentini the point of views of the “Poste Italiane” company.

An Important contribution was made, by videoconference from Brussels, by the General Bologna, on what is doing the NATO on this argument.

Subsequently Lawyer Alessandra Finocchio, as a part of the Technical/Scientific’s  committee of  “Cloud for Defence” has emphasized the importance of contractual aspects as part of the Cloud Computing services acquisitions.

After has been the moment of presentation of the study “Cloud Computing in Public administration’s Departements”, done by the Network’s Companies “Cloud For Defence” (www.cloud4defence.eu).

Leandro Aglieri, CEO of Cloud for Defence, has explained that the major concern of public administrators with the transition to Cloud Computing concern the “lack of trust for the protection of data privacy.”

Cloud for Defence, that uses the Star methodology of Cloud Security Alliance, aims to provide to P.A. decision-makers, the awareness of security levels for each of the architectures, already implemented or planned to be adopted.

At the closure of the meeting, major Industries, that produces the “building blocks” of the Cloud, has presented their solutions:
IBM’s engineer Pullo, Business-e with Mr. Mancini and SELTA’s CEO Dr. Tagliaferri.
